新世纪以来,我国建筑行业得到了空前的发展与繁荣。就目前的建筑工程项目而言,其在施工中较多的采用了高支模技术,但是由于施工技术和施工方法的不科学、不完善,造成的高支模失稳坍塌现象屡屡出现,不但造成工程施工质量和人员伤亡事故,更是造成企业经济损失和恶劣的社会影响。近年来的社会发展中,各种新技术和概念的引进使得人们在工作的过程中对于高支模技术也提出了新的标准和要求,为现代化工程施工技术的优化和完善提出了良好可靠的基础依据。本文就高支模概念与特点入手分析,提出了高支模技术在施工中的应用效益和优势。
